Toyota Static Induction Transistor
Toyota offers the uniquely designed Static Induction Transistor Control Panel that features a Digital Multi-Display Monitor. This monitor is the very first of its kind in the business. This specific tool offers a window to pretty much every important aspect in the performance parameters of your electric forklift.
The proven engine and powertrain designs offer rugged 5-main bearing crankshafts to help lessen vibration. This design also helps to minimize stress, ensuring a longer lifespan. There are hydraulic lifters utilized also. These parts can help lessen maintenance and lessen noise.

From an environmental viewpoint, the future of these machines is electric. In an effort to continually meet the expanding requirement for more effective and cleaner electric lift trucks, Toyota recently launched a line of forklifts which provides AC-powered electric models with 4-wheel drive. The AC-powered system is made up of many subsystems. These work to conserve energy and to regenerate power in order to extend battery run time and maximize operational productivity in between battery charges.
The new 8-Series machinery are made to minimize the performance gap between IC engines by offering as much as 21 percent faster travel speeds.
